Fireplace ideas for a living room

Practical, tasteful fireplace ideas for a living room: a marble surround focal point, a media wall electric fire, a calm limestone surround or a stove in a chamber.

The best fireplace ideas for a living room start with the room, not the fireplace. Decide what you want the fireplace to do, anchor the room as a focal point, hold a television on a media wall, or bring quiet warmth, then choose the design and stone to match. Everything is cut to your room in our workshop.

A fireplace is usually the thing your eye lands on first. Get the proportions and materials right and the whole room settles around it. Below are practical, tasteful ideas that work in real living rooms, from grand to gentle.

A made-to-measure marble surround as the focal point

If you want one clear centrepiece, a marble surround is hard to beat. It gives the room a natural focal point, a sense of permanence and a touch of elegance that lifts everything around it.

Marble works because of its depth and movement. Veining catches the light and gives the surround life, so even a simple shape feels considered. A white or grey marble suits a bright, contemporary room. A darker veined marble makes a bolder statement and anchors a larger space. A softer cream reads as warm and classic.

The key is proportion. A surround that is too small looks lost on a big chimney breast, and one that is too large can overwhelm a modest room. Because we cut every piece to measure, we size the surround to your wall, your ceiling height and your hearth, so it sits in balance. A media wall with an inset electric fire

If your television and fireplace compete for the same wall, a media wall solves it. An inset electric fire sits neatly below or beside the screen, giving you flame and TV in one calm, integrated feature.

This is one of the most popular living room ideas we are asked about, and for good reason. An electric fire needs no flue and no gas, so it can go almost anywhere. The flame effect runs with or without heat, which means you can enjoy the look on a mild evening without warming the room. It suits modern homes and open-plan spaces particularly well.

The finish is what makes a media wall feel high-end rather than boxy. A stone surround, a slim hearth or a marble slip around the fire lifts the whole wall and stops it feeling like flat plasterboard. A limestone surround for a calmer scheme

If you want warmth without drama, limestone is the answer. Its soft, matte, cream character brings a gentle, timeless feel that suits relaxed and traditional rooms alike.

Limestone does not shout. It has a quiet elegance that works beautifully in rooms with muted colours, natural textures and plenty of soft furnishings. It pairs naturally with oak floors, warm metals and country-style or classic interiors. Where marble makes a statement, limestone creates calm.

It is also endlessly flexible in shape. A simple, clean surround feels contemporary, while a more detailed profile leans traditional. Because the tone is so soft, limestone rarely fights the rest of the room, which makes it a safe and lovely choice when you want the fireplace to feel restful rather than commanding.

A stove in a chamber for warmth and character

For real presence and genuine heat, a stove set into a chamber is a wonderful living room feature. The chamber frames the stove, protects the surrounding wall and gives the fireplace a solid, grounded look.

A stove brings a focal point and a source of warmth in one. We build stove chambers and cut hearths and beams to suit, whether you want a rustic timber beam above a stone chamber or a cleaner, more contemporary opening. The stove sits within, framed and finished so it looks intentional rather than added on.

Chambers work in both period and modern homes. In an older property they suit an inglenook feel. In a newer home a crisp, square chamber with a slim stone hearth looks sharp and current. What proportions suit a living room?

Scale the fireplace to the room, not to a catalogue. The surround should feel generous without dominating, and the mantel height, opening size and hearth depth all need to relate to the wall and the space in front of it.

A few guidelines help. On a tall chimney breast you can afford a larger, more detailed surround. In a room with a low ceiling, a slimmer profile keeps things in proportion. The hearth should give the fire room to breathe and, where relevant, meet safety distances for a stove or gas fire. Leave enough clear wall around the surround so it reads as a feature rather than a squeeze.

This is exactly where made-to-measure earns its keep. Standard sizes rarely fit a real room perfectly. FAQ

What is the most popular living room fireplace right now?

Two ideas lead at the moment. Media walls with an inset electric fire suit modern, open homes, and classic marble surrounds remain a favourite for a timeless focal point. The right choice depends on your room and how you want to use the space.

Can I have a fireplace without a chimney?

Yes. Electric fires need no flue at all, which makes them ideal for homes without a chimney. Some gas and stove options require a flue or liner. We will talk you through what your room can take during a consultation.

Do I need a big room for a marble surround?

No. Marble suits smaller rooms too, as long as the proportions are right. We size the surround to your wall so it feels balanced rather than heavy. In a compact room a lighter stone and a neat profile keep things elegant.

Is an electric fire warm enough for a living room?

Modern electric fires give a good level of heat for most living rooms, and the flame effect runs independently of the heat. For a main heat source in a larger space, a stove or gas fire may suit better. We can advise based on your room.

How long does a made-to-measure fireplace take?

It depends on the design and stone, as each piece is cut and finished in our workshop. We give you a clear timescale once the design is settled. Starting with a design consultation is the quickest way to a firm answer.

Can you match the fireplace to my existing decor?

Yes. That is the point of made-to-measure. We choose the stone, finish and proportions to sit with your floors, fittings and colour scheme, so the fireplace feels part of the room rather than dropped into it.
